Description:
London: Printed by W. Brown and A. O'Neil, 1793. Second edition, with additions. Engraved frontispiece 29 copper engraved plates after Shearer and Hepplewhite. xvi, 266 pp + [24] leaves of letterpress tables printed on one side only. 1 vols. 4to. Old quarter calf and boards. Spine rubbed, lower board detached, several plates trimmed just inside plate line with loss of numeral in one plate, otherwise clean internally. Second edition, with additions. Engraved frontispiece 29 copper engraved plates after Shearer and Hepplewhite. xvi, 266 pp + [24] leaves of letterpress tables printed on one side only. 1 vols. 4to. Second edition, with 9 additional plates. Provenance: J. Thomas, Cabinet Maker and Upholsterer, Ock St, Abingdon, (ink stamp in lower margin of title). Kress 15605; ESTC T120479
